#gallery li {
	display: inline;
	margin-right: 3px;
}
#gallery #main-img {
	padding: 12px;
	border: 6px dashed #5F9EA0;
	box-shadow: 5px 5px 5px #888888;
}

#menu ul {
	list-style-type:none;
	margin:0;
	padding:0;
	overflow:hidden;
}

#menu li {
	float:left;
}

#menu a:link, a:visited
{
	display:block;
	width:200px;
	height:50px;
	font-weight:bold;
	color:#FFFFFF;
	background-color:#98bf21;
	text-align:center;
	padding:8px;
	text-decoration:none;
	text-transform:uppercase;
	margin-top:20px;
	font-size:24px;

}
#menu a:hover
{
	background-color:#7A991A;
}

#menu img {
	margin-left:50px;
	margin-right:20px;
}

#main {
  width: 800px ;
  margin-left: auto ;
  margin-right: auto ;
  font-family:"Lucida Console",Times,serif;
  margin-bottom: 50px;
  
}

#page {
	border: 1px solid black ;
	width: 1200px ;
    margin-left: auto ;
    margin-right: auto ;
    font-family: 'Germania One', cursive;
    font-weight: 400;
    box-shadow: 5px 5px 5px #888888;
    background-color:#FFFFFF;
}

#footer {
	height: 100px;
	color:#FFFFFF;
	font-size: x-small;
	background-color:#5A5E5E;
	padding: 20px;

}

#scores {
	border: 2px solid green;
}

#scores td {
	font-family:"Lucida Console",Times,serif;
	color:#000000;
	border: 1px solid green;
	padding: 5px;
}

#scores a:link, a:visited {
	color:#000000;
	text-decoration:none;
}


#tiedoite {
	border: 5px solid black;
	background-color:gray;
	padding: 20px;
}

body {
	background: -webkit-linear-gradient(gray, black); /* For Safari 5.1 to 6.0 */
	background: -o-linear-gradient(gray, black); /* For Opera 11.1 to 12.0 */
	background: -moz-linear-gradient(gray, black); /* For Firefox 3.6 to 15 */
	background: linear-gradient(gray, black); /* Standard syntax (must be last) */
}